How Our Moisture Detection Service Actually Works
When you call us for Moisture Detection Services,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ive within 60 minutes to assess the situation and get started on the drying process. Our technicians use specialized equipment, like th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ters, to locate and measure the extent of the damage. We’ll work tirelessly to dry and dehumidify the affected area, using equipment like desiccant dehumidifiers and air scrubbers to remove excess moisture.

Moisture Detection Services v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, isolated water leak |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self and prevent further damage. |
| Large water leak or widespread moisture damage | No | Yes | You need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a proper drying process. |
| Unknown source of moisture | No | Yes | You need a professional to locate the source and recommend the best course of action. |
| Health concerns due to mold or mildew | No | Yes | You need a professional to assess and address the situation to ensure your health and safety. |
| High-value or sensitive items affected by moisture | No | Yes | You need a professional to ensure the best possible outcome and prevent further damage to your belongings. |
| Time-sensitive situation (e.g., after a flood) | No | Yes | You need a professional to respond quickly and effectively to prevent further damage and ensure a timely resolution. |

Moisture Detection Services Cost in Takoma Park, MD
The cost of Moisture Detection Services can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Takoma Park,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sub-services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$500 – $2,000 | The size and complexity of the affected area, as well as the presence of mold or mildew. |
| Equipment Setup and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| The number and type of equipment needed, as well as the duration of the drying process. |
| Final Inspection and Repair | $500 – $2,500 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repairs. |
| Moisture Detection Equipment Rental | $200 – $1,000 | The type and duration of equipment rental, as well as the presence of specialized equipment needs. |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, contents restoration) | $1,000 – $10,000 | The scope and complexity of the more services needed. |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ment and the specific needs of your situation. We offer free estimates for all our services.
